Pros

In the right team you'll work with great people and learn all the time. Microsoft is involved in a huge number of different products and roles, and mobility within the company is normally fairly easy. It can actually be a great place to learn new skills - after you've built a track record of success people will give you a try at things you probably wouldn't have been hired into directly.

Cons

In the wrong team you'll work against great people and make each other dumber. Don't expect your management to help you find a good fit - it just isn't something the company is good at. You need to manage your own career. Keep shopping yourself around. Don't get stale.
